Let's not forget that Zane was one of the few people to beat Arnold Schwarzenegger - pretty impressive for a "light weight".

Here is some other interesting info:

Frank Zane won Mr. Olympia, bodybuilding's highest title, 3 times: 1977, 1978, 1979.



Defeated Arnold Schwarzenegger in the 1968 Mr. Universe competition in Miami , Florida. He also won Mr. Universe 2 more times in London, England in 1970 and 1972.

Oh - the other part of the symmetry that is harder to judge is "intelligence". Zane is one of the most educated Bodybuilders in the history of the sport.

Well, symmetry refers to equal balance of both sides...proportion refers to balance between muscle groups...aesthetics has more to do with the "beauty" of how its put together. So who has/had the best combined?

-Flex
-Shawn
-Lee L
-Bob Paris
-Zane
-Benfatto
-Rory L
-Cormier

To name a few...
